Les Musiciens et la Grande Guerre vol. 7

Les altistes engagés

 

Diapason, 5 diapasons

During the Great War most composers enlisted in the service of their country, mobilised at the front or in the service of the population at home.
Opposition or silence were the exception. Whether they were drafted (Hindemith and Schmitt), engaged as volunteers like Vaughan Williams, or civilians in a humanitarian organisation (Koechlin), all did their duty, all the while continuing to compose. Their language evolved with considerable liberty and spontaneity. These four composer offered the viola a sonorous and expressive range of tremendous richness, backed up by embracing and generous piano scores.

Vincent Roth, alto
Sébastien Beck, piano
